Understanding Pulse Stimulator Devices

Pulse stimulator devices are designed to deliver controlled electrical impulses to specific parts of the body. These impulses can help in pain relief, muscle rehabilitation, and even the treatment of certain neurological disorders. By targeting nerves and muscles, these devices can enhance the body's natural healing processes.

The technology behind pulse stimulators is grounded in the principle of neuromuscular electrical stimulation (NMES). This technique stimulates muscle contractions by mimicking the signals sent by the nervous system, thereby improving strength and reducing muscle atrophy.

Applications in Pain Management

One of the most common uses of pulse stimulator devices is in pain management. Conditions such as chronic back pain, arthritis, and post-surgical discomfort can be effectively managed with these devices. They work by interrupting pain signals sent to the brain, providing relief without the need for medication.

Patients using pulse stimulators for pain management often report reduced reliance on painkillers, which can have unwanted side effects. This makes these devices an attractive option for both patients and healthcare providers looking to minimize drug dependency.

Rehabilitation and Muscle Recovery

In the realm of physical therapy, pulse stimulators play a crucial role in muscle recovery and rehabilitation. After an injury or surgery, these devices can be used to improve muscle function and accelerate recovery times. They help maintain muscle mass, improve circulation, and reduce swelling.

Enhancing Athletic Performance

Athletes also benefit from pulse stimulator devices, using them to enhance performance and prevent injuries. By promoting faster recovery after intense training sessions, these devices enable athletes to train harder and more frequently without risking overuse injuries.

Moreover, pulse stimulators can be used in strength training programs to target specific muscle groups, providing a competitive edge in various sports. The ability to customize the intensity and frequency of the impulses allows for tailored training regimens.

Future Prospects and Innovations

The future of pulse stimulator devices looks promising, with ongoing research and technological advancements expanding their applications. Newer models are becoming more user-friendly, portable, and accessible, making them suitable for home use.

Innovations such as wireless connectivity and app integrations are further enhancing the functionality of these devices, allowing for remote monitoring and personalized treatment plans. As the technology continues to evolve, the role of pulse stimulators in modern medicine is set to grow even further.
